No. 3 SPU Women Win 54th Straight Regular Season Game
February 12, 2004

SEATTLE (Feb. 12) ­ Mandy Wood came off the bench to score 15 points as the No. 3 Seattle Pacific University women's basketball team beat Alaska Anchorage 69-45 on Thursday in Great Northwest Athletic Conference action at Brougham Pavilion.

The win pushed the Falcons' (21-0, 12-0 GNAC) regular season win streak to 54 games and their conference string now stands at 36 straight. It was also Seattle Pacific’s 43rd consecutive regular season victory at home.

Joining Wood (So., 5-7, Port Angeles, Wa.) in double figures for SPU were Amy Taylor (Jr., 5-8, Shoreline, Wa./Shorewood-Oregon) with 13, Valerie Gustafson (Sr., 6-0, Olympia, Wa./Black Hills) with 11 and Carli Smith (So., 5-11, Spokane, Wa./Valley Christian) had 10. Brittney Kroon (So., 6-4, Wasilla, Ak.) added nine points, 11 rebounds and four blocks.

The Seawolves (9-12, 4-8 GNAC) were within 19-14 with 9:04 to go in the first half before the Falcons outscored UAA 22-7 the rest of the way to take a 41-21 halftime lead. Seattle Pacific took its largest lead at 69-40 with 6:44 left, but was held scoreless for the remainder of the game.

Both teams struggled from the field as SPU shot 36 percent (26-72) and Anchorage was held to just 31 percent (17-55). The Falcons were on target from behind the arc, hitting 45 percent (9-20) of their threes. SPU won the battle of the boards, 51-37, and forced 23 Anchorage turnovers.

Kamie Jo Massey led Anchorage with 21 points and 16 rebounds. Tanya Nizich added 15 points for UAA.

Seattle Pacific hosts Alaska Fairbanks Saturday at 5 p.m.
